Chapter 1

"Owwww" I groaned loudly as mutt bit into my right arm, I dropped the books I was about reading on my bed and picked him by his tail up to my eye level.

"Don't be a bad boy ok?", I purred despite the pain I felt from the bite, the area around it was already turning a painful red, it would likely turn into a blister soon.

I loved mutt alot despite the warnings of mother and father not to be too close to him, because such tight bonds might accidentally create a connection, an unbreakable connection between us.

It was believed that having such connections with a creature might have drastic effects on the human, as whatever one feels would affect the other, and if unfortunately one dies then a part of the other dies as well.

They've tried taking mutt far from me as often as possible but he still finds his way back every single time. Father once ordered a palace guard to lock him up with tiny chains in a tiny cage and he was to be kept at an isolated part of the castle, I cried a lot when I came to hear of it because I couldn't imagine my mutt all alone and in the cold, I even begged Father to let him go and promised I wouldn't be so close anymore but he bluntly refused, I have broken other promises about staying away and he didn't think I'd stay away now.

He ordered me back to my room escorted by a guard, I sniffed silently as we climbed the spiralling staircase back up to my room door.

"Don't worry, I can go up by myself now", I said backing the guard already halfway up the stairs to my room.

"Are you sure you can manage princess?", He asked, his words laced in concern.

"Yes you can go" I replied as I resumed my climb up.

I got to my door and saw through my eagle eyes the guard still on the stair I left him. I opened my door and got swallowed in the dark, I tried making my eyes get used to the it and could just make out the matches I kept on my table.

I groped my way closer, my arms outstretched to make out whatever obstacle might be in my way and finally got a hold of the lighter. I managed towards the fireplace built directly opposite my bed, and struck a match on the stonewall, it sparked and went out. I tried another and it caught flames, covering it with my left palm against the breeze coming through my window, I lowered myself and threw it into the already arranged logs there. I watched as it spread steadily through the wood and illuminate the room.

Now I could just make out my closet by the wall close to my bathroom door, it stood at the end of my room slightly farther than the soft cushions from my bed. A round large rug was spread by my bed with two cushions places on it and a stool at their middle, by the other side of my bed was a knee height shelf where I arranged my book collections, consisting mostly of novels about mystical creatures.

I glanced towards my mirror and caught sight of how awful I looked, I tried dabbing my eyes with my hands to reduce their puffiness and climbed into bed thinking about how lonely I'm going to be for days or even weeks.

I would just have to bear till mutt comes out, I thought to myself, trying to calm my nerves down.

I adjusted myself on my bed, covering myself up and turned on my side facing the window, I closed my eyes and was about dozing when I heard a thud on my room window, I decided to ignore it with my eyes still closed and tried going back to sleep. A thud again and it was louder this time, I jumped out of bed and walked towards my window, opening it, I peeked outside trying to understand where the sound was coming from when I felt something hit my face and get tangled in my hair.

"Arghhhhhhhhh" I screamed as I fought, relentlessly trying to get it out of my hair. I finally got it out and threw it over the floor to the other side of the room.

I heard a soft hiss accompanied with a soft painful Yelp, I walked towards the strange flying thing and recognized it immediately.

"Oh mutt", I cried out, feeling hot with joy, I knelt by him gathering him up in my arms, he could fit the size of my palm, he was so small.

"I'm sorry, you scared me" I soothed as I rubbed his head to the tip of his tail repeatedly till he completely calmed down.

"Are you okay princess?" I heard outside my door.

"Yeah yeah I'm fine", I replied back.

Mutt looked up at me with his two large eyes, completely black and shiny as marbles, they always gave me bumps when I stared into them. Then he purred contentedly and curled up into a ball on my palm.

I placed him on the little blanket I made for him on my book shelf and he soon started snoring.

"Goodnight mutt" I muttered silently while drifting off to sleep.
